   ### What happened
   
   I found that when MySQL CDC processes JSON type data, the structure read is 
inconsistent with the original data in the database
   The original data is: f_json is {"key": "value"} with a space in between. I 
checked MySQL binlog and it also has a space, as shown below:

   But when I delete data, the data in SeaTunnelRecord was: {"key":"value"} 
without any spaces. It lead to Redis cannot delete data because the data format 
is inconsistent. I printed the log as follows:
